<address id="thnfp"></address>

    <address id="thnfp"><th id="thnfp"><progress id="thnfp"></progress></th></address>
    <listing id="thnfp"><nobr id="thnfp"><meter id="thnfp"></meter></nobr></listing>
    以文本方式查看主題

    -  安易免費財務軟件交流論壇  (http://m.gangyx.cn/bbs/index.asp)
    --  電腦知識交流  (http://m.gangyx.cn/bbs/list.asp?boardid=11)
    ----  Microsoft SQL Server 擴展存儲過程安裝與卸載  (http://m.gangyx.cn/bbs/dispbbs.asp?boardid=11&id=40098)

    --  作者:chinafish
    --  發布時間:2013/6/27 22:13:04
    --  Microsoft SQL Server 擴展存儲過程安裝與卸載
    假設已經做好擴展存儲過程的DLL文件為dbxp_skate.dll
    --首先要將dll文件(dbxp_skate.dll)拷貝到sql程序所在的binn目錄,例如C:\\Program Files\\Microsoft SQL Server\\MSSQL\\Binn
    --安裝擴展存儲過程
    exec master..sp_addextendedproc \'xp_dbevent\', \'dbxp_skate.dll\'
    --調用擴展存儲過程
    exec master..xp_dbevent 1,\'a\',\'b\'
    --執行 sp_helpextendedproc 以顯示當前由 SQL Server 裝載的 DLL 文件。
    exec sp_helpextendedproc @funcname = \'xp_dbevent\'  --察看xp_dbevent所屬的DLL
    exec sp_helpextendedproc       --察看SQL Server 裝載的 DLL 文件
    --卸載擴展存儲過程
    exec master..sp_dropextendedproc \'xp_dbevent\'
    --從內存中卸載指定的擴展存儲過程動態鏈接庫(dbxp_skate.dll)
    dbcc dbxp_skate(free
    Channel